I Brought a Nintendo Switch 2 - It's Easy to See Why It's the Fastest-Selling Gaming Console Ever
- Nintendo launched the Switch 2 console on June 5, 2025, marking the fastest-selling Nintendo console ever in the UK.
- The successful launch of Switch 2 was driven by strong demand and surpassed previous Nintendo records, selling more than twice the number of units compared to the original Switch’s debut in the UK.
- At launch in the UK, Switch 2 ranked as the fourth highest-selling console in terms of units, following the PS5, PS4, and Xbox Series X/S, and it outperformed the 2010 Nintendo 3DS launch in both sales and revenue.
- According to NielsenIQ, the launch sales of the first Nintendo Switch in the UK reached around 80,000 units, while the 3DS debuted with 113,000 units sold. In comparison, the Switch 2 achieved a record-breaking weekend in France, moving more than 200,000 units in its initial launch period.
- Nintendo anticipates selling 15 million units of the Switch 2 worldwide by the end of the 2025-2026 fiscal year, demonstrating sustained demand despite criticism over pricing and a competitive market landscape.

Kerry Wan/ZDNETWhile the Nintendo Switch 2 launched only a week ago, it's already set the record for being the fastest-selling Nintendo console ever. Today, the company shared that the latest 2-in-1 gaming system sold over 3.5 million units worldwide in its first four days.
